Pediatric Orthodontics and Interceptive Growth

Parents searching for a highly reviewed pediatric orthodontist miami fl trust our studio for expert interceptive care. When should a child first see an orthodontist in Davie? The American Association of Orthodontists recommends age seven. Why do orthodontists want to see 7 year old children? It is all about interceptive growth. By capturing biological windows between the ages of 7 and 10, we can guide jaw development and often prevent the need for complex jaw surgeries later in life. Clinical Warning Signs for Age 7 Screenings

Warning Sign What It Could Indicate Recommended Action
Early or late loss of baby teeth Developmental timing issues, crowding risk Schedule orthodontic evaluation within 30 days
Mouth breathing or snoring Airway constriction, sleep disordered breathing Request 3D CBCT airway analysis
Thumb sucking past age 4 Narrow palate, anterior open bite forming Interceptive habit appliance evaluation
Teeth that do not meet when biting Open bite or crossbite developing Immediate orthodontic consultation
Jaw shifting or clicking sounds TMJ stress, asymmetric growth Full joint and growth assessment

For clear aligner patients, the humidity means you need to be extra vigilant about cleaning. The best way to clean clear aligners is using specialized aligner cleaning crystals or a soft brush with mild, clear antibacterial soap and cool water. Never use regular toothpaste; it is highly abrasive and will create micro scratches that make your aligners look cloudy and trap bacteria. If your aligners do get cloudy or stained, soaking them in a professional retainer or aligner cleaning solution will lift stains and restore clarity. Most patients experience mild pressure for only the first 24 to 48 hours of wearing a new tray as the teeth begin to move. Clear aligners are generally much more comfortable than metal braces because there are no wires to poke the cheeks or gums. Our precision 3D printing ensures a custom scalloped fit along your gumline to prevent irritation. If needed, orthodontic wax can provide temporary relief.

When it comes to eating with braces, avoid hard, sticky, chewy, or crunchy foods like ice, hard candies, nuts, and chewing gum during the first week. Can you eat pizza with traditional metal braces? Yes, but cut the firm crust into small, bite sized pieces rather than tearing into it with your front teeth. Breaking brackets by eating hard or crunchy foods delays your treatment progress, so stay smart about your choices.

Does Florida Medicaid Cover Braces for Teenagers in Miami

I get calls every single week from parents asking does florida medicaid cover braces for teenagers in miami. Here is the straight answer. Florida Medicaid does cover braces for patients under 21 when the case meets strict medical necessity criteria. We are talking about severe malocclusions with objective scoring that qualifies under the Handicapping Labio-Lingual Deviation index. Cosmetic cases do not qualify. A child with mild crowding and no functional impairment will not get approved. A teenager with a 9mm overjet, traumatic deep bite causing palatal tissue damage, or a crossbite with mandibular shift has a strong chance. Our team handles the entire prior authorization process from start to finish. We take the clinical photos, we compile the cephalometric measurements, we submit the narrative, and we fight the appeal if denied. I have seen too many families give up after a first denial when the case was completely winnable with proper documentation. If you are wondering what qualifies a child for Medicaid braces in Florida, the answer is a score of 26 or higher on the state approved index, plus documented functional impairment. Benefits of Early Orthodontic Intervention and Why Age 7 Matters

Parents in Weston and Cooper City have gotten extremely strategic about this. I see it in my scheduling patterns. They book Phase 1 consultations in late summer, right before the school year chaos begins, so any appliance placement happens during Labor Day week when kids are already adjusting to new routines. Smart. The benefits of early orthodontic intervention weston fl extend way beyond just straightening teeth. We are shaping jaw growth during the only window where we actually can. Between ages 7 and 10, the mid-palatal suture has not fused yet. We can expand the upper jaw orthopedically, create space for crowded permanent teeth, correct crossbites that would otherwise require surgical correction later, and address mouth breathing that contributes to sleep disordered breathing and poor facial development. Can early orthodontics completely prevent the need for braces later? Sometimes yes, sometimes no. A child who finishes Phase 1 with adequate arch development and proper jaw relationships might need only minor alignment in adolescence, or no further treatment at all. Others will need a shorter, simpler Phase 2. Either way, you are buying insurance against extractions and jaw surgery. What exact age is considered early intervention orthodontics? The American Association of Orthodontists says age 7 for the first screening. Treatment typically begins between 8 and 10, depending on dental age and skeletal maturity. Are Clear Aligners Painful for the First Week and What to Expect

New patients searching are clear aligners painful for the first week pembroke pines want the honest truth, not sugar coated marketing. Yes, there is pressure. Your teeth are moving through bone. Anyone who tells you it feels like nothing is lying to make a sale. Most patients experience mild to moderate pressure for the first 24 to 48 hours of wearing a new tray. The first tray in the series tends to be the most noticeable because your teeth have never experienced controlled force before. After that, each subsequent tray causes significantly less discomfort. Clear aligners are generally much more comfortable than metal braces because there are no wires to poke your cheeks or brackets to shred your lips. Our precision 3D printed aligners have a custom scalloped fit along your gumline to prevent irritation. If you do experience edge roughness, a clean nail file gently run along the border solves it in seconds. For gum irritation, orthodontic wax provides immediate relief. The key is switching to your next tray at night right before bed, so you sleep through the first several hours of maximum pressure. Ibuprofen is fine for the first day or two, but avoid it long term because NSAIDs can theoretically slow tooth movement by inhibiting prostaglandin synthesis. Acetaminophen is a safer choice for ongoing discomfort.

Urgent Orthodontic Repair and What Qualifies as an Emergency

Something breaks on a Saturday night. Of course it does. A wire pops loose while you are eating dinner in Davie. A bracket shears off during a weekend soccer game. You need an urgent orthodontic repair appointment davie fl and you are panicking because every office seems closed. Here is what you need to know. What qualifies as an orthodontic emergency includes severe unmanageable pain not controlled by over the counter medication, facial swelling indicating infection, or significant trauma to the mouth that displaces teeth or causes bleeding that will not stop. A loose bracket, a poking wire, or minor aligner discomfort does not constitute an emergency. Those are comfort issues we handle promptly during business hours. Can any orthodontist fix a broken bracket? Technically yes, but I strongly advise against having a provider who did not start your case repair your appliances. Different bracket systems have different torque prescriptions and base designs. A generic replacement bracket placed by someone unfamiliar with your treatment plan can introduce biomechanical errors that extend treatment time. Adult Treatment, Ceramic Braces, and the Miami Glow Up Mindset

The adult patient who walks into our studio is different from the teenager dragged in by a parent. They have thought about this for years. They have researched, saved, and built up the courage to finally do something for themselves. When someone searches book appointment for ceramic braces in fort lauderdale, they are ready. Are ceramic braces more expensive than metal braces? Slightly, because the polycrystalline alumina brackets cost more to manufacture. But the aesthetic difference is dramatic. Ceramic brackets blend with your natural tooth shade and are far less noticeable in professional settings. Do ceramic braces stain easily over time? The brackets themselves do not stain. The clear elastic ligatures that hold the archwire in place can discolor if you drink coffee, red wine, or eat curry without rinsing afterward. We change those elastics at every adjustment visit, so staining is a temporary cosmetic issue, not a permanent one. How long do ceramic braces take to work compared to metal? Essentially the same treatment time. Modern ceramic brackets have metal reinforced slots that reduce friction to levels comparable to metal brackets. The limiting factor is your biology, not the bracket material. Lingual Braces for Professionals: Complete Invisibility Without Sacrificing Capability

I recently treated a trial attorney from Fort Lauderdale who argued cases in front of juries every month. He needed full orthodontic correction but could not afford even a hint of visible hardware during trial. Clear aligners were not ideal for his complex open bite. The solution was lingual braces. For professionals searching pros and cons of lingual braces for professionals weston, here is the unfiltered reality. Lingual braces are brackets and wires placed on the back surfaces of your teeth. They are completely invisible from the front. Nobody knows you are in treatment unless you tell them.

Direct Answer: Lingual braces offer total invisibility and handle complex cases that clear aligners struggle with. The adjustment period for speech lasts a few days to one week. They cost more than traditional braces due to custom fabrication requirements, with payment plans available that make them accessible.

The biggest advantage is capability. Lingual systems like Win and Inbrace correct severe rotations, extractions, and surgical cases that would exceed the limits of clear aligner therapy. The biggest downside is comfort during the adaptation phase. Your tongue needs time to adjust to the presence of brackets on the lingual surfaces. Most patients speak normally within five to seven days. I tell my professionals to schedule bonding on a Thursday or Friday so they have the weekend to adapt before Monday morning meetings. Can you talk normally while wearing lingual braces? Absolutely. The tongue adapts remarkably fast. Within two weeks, most patients report zero speech difference. The other consideration is hygiene. Flossing behind the teeth takes more effort. We provide specialized floss threaders and water flossers to every lingual patient. Signs You Need Braces as an Adult and Why Waiting Is a Losing Strategy

Adults in South Florida tell me the same story over and over. They noticed shifting in their late twenties. They ignored it. By thirty five, the crowding got worse. By forty, a front tooth started flaring outward in every photo. Now they are fifty and self conscious about smiling in their daughter's wedding pictures. The signs you might need braces as an adult south florida are not mysterious. Your body tells you. Teeth that overlap more than they did five years ago. New spaces opening between front teeth. Floss getting stuck or shredding where it never used to. Jaw soreness in the morning from clenching driven by a misaligned bite. Clicking or popping sounds when you chew. Headaches that originate in your temples and radiate forward. These are all mechanical problems. And mechanical problems do not fix themselves.

Direct Answer: Key signs adults need orthodontic treatment include progressive crowding, new gaps appearing between teeth, increasing difficulty flossing, jaw clicking or pain, morning headaches, and teeth that no longer meet correctly when biting. Ignoring these signs leads to uneven wear, gum recession, and more expensive correction later.

Is it ever too late in life to get braces? No. I have treated patients in their seventies who decided they were done hiding their smile. Bone is living tissue. It remodels at any age. The limiting factor is not your biology. It is gum health, bone volume, and your willingness to commit. What happens if you need braces but decide not to get them? The shifting accelerates. Uneven tooth contact causes localized wear facets. Those wear facets turn into sensitivity, then fractures, then crowns. A five thousand dollar orthodontic problem becomes a twenty five thousand dollar restorative nightmare. The Unfiltered Truth About Eating With Braces in South Florida

A teenager from Cooper City asked me last week if he could eat a Cuban sandwich with his new metal braces. I told him the truth. Yes, but not the way he wants to. You have to cut it into small pieces and chew carefully with your back teeth. The real question behind the food questions is always the same: how much will braces disrupt my life? The answer depends on how smart your choices are in the first thirty days.

Direct Answer: With metal braces, avoid hard, sticky, chewy, and crunchy foods like ice, hard candies, caramel, popcorn, nuts, and whole apples. Pizza is fine if you cut the crust into small bite sized pieces. Breaking a bracket by eating the wrong food delays your treatment by weeks.

Week one is the hardest. Your teeth are sore from the initial archwire engagement. Stick to soft foods: yogurt, smoothies, scrambled eggs, mashed potatoes, soup, pasta, and soft bread. After the soreness fades, you still need to avoid anything that can shear a bracket off or bend a wire. Hard pretzels, tortilla chips, corn on the cob, and chewy bagels are the most common bracket killers I see. What happens if you eat hard or crunchy food with braces? The bracket debonds from the tooth surface. Now you need an emergency repair visit. That loose bracket is no longer applying controlled force. It is just sitting there, dead weight, while your treatment clock keeps ticking. Every broken bracket adds weeks to your total treatment time. Is it worth the five seconds of crunch? Probably not. Keeping Clear Aligners Crystal Clear in South Florida Humidity

South Florida's humidity does more than ruin your hair. It creates a breeding ground for bacteria on aligner trays that sit in a warm, moist environment for twenty two hours a day. Patients searching how to clean clear aligners properly at home miami often default to terrible habits like brushing them with toothpaste or rinsing them in hot water. Both destroy your aligners. Toothpaste is abrasive. It creates micro scratches across the aligner surface. Those scratches become opaque over time and trap biofilm you cannot see. Hot water warps the thermoplastic material. Even warm water can distort the precise fit we engineered for your tooth movements.

Direct Answer: Clean clear aligners with specialized aligner cleaning crystals or a soft brush with mild clear antibacterial soap and cool water. Never use toothpaste, hot water, or mouthwash with alcohol. Soak aligners daily to prevent clouding and bacterial buildup. Store them in water when not in use to prevent biofilm drying and hardening.

How do you clean cloudy or stained aligners effectively? Soak them in a professional retainer cleaning solution or denture cleaning tablet dissolved in cool water for twenty minutes. Gently brush with a soft bristle toothbrush reserved only for your aligners. Rinse thoroughly. If you eat or drink anything other than water with your aligners in, rinse them immediately. Leaving sugary or acidic residue trapped against your enamel for hours creates a cavity factory. I tell my patients to think of their aligners like expensive designer sunglasses. You would not clean those with gritty toothpaste and hot water. Treat your aligners with the same respect. Wisdom Teeth and Braces: The Timing Question Every Patient Asks

Should you get your wisdom teeth removed before starting braces? The internet is full of conflicting advice on this. Some dentists insist on preemptive removal. Some say wait. The correct answer depends on your specific anatomy, which is why a CBCT scan matters so much. If your wisdom teeth are fully impacted and positioned in a way that could resorb the roots of your second molars, removal before orthodontic treatment may be the safest path. If they are upright, fully erupted, and have adequate bone support, they can stay right where they are during treatment. I have managed hundreds of cases where wisdom teeth remained in place throughout braces with zero complications.

Direct Answer: Wisdom teeth removal is not automatically required before braces. The decision depends on CBCT imaging showing impaction angle, proximity to second molar roots, and whether cysts or pathology are present. Wisdom teeth do not cause orthodontic relapse. That myth has been debunked by decades of research.

Do orthodontists always recommend removing wisdom teeth? No. That recommendation should be case specific, not automatic. What I see too often is young adults being told their wisdom teeth "pushed their teeth forward" years after braces ended. As I explained in our discussion on relapse, mesial drift is the biological reality regardless of wisdom tooth presence. Teeth shift forward naturally with age. Retention appliances are the only protection. Removing wisdom teeth does not prevent shifting. Consistent retainer wear does. If your wisdom teeth are healthy, asymptomatic, and not threatening adjacent structures, I see no urgency to extract them.
